Bjrn von Sydow: The Swedish Politician and Statesman

A Lifetime of Public Service

Bjrn von Sydow is a Swedish politician and statesman, best known for serving as the Speaker of the Riksdag, the Swedish parliament, from 2002 to 2006. During his tenure, he played a crucial role in shaping the country's political landscape, earning him a reputation as a respected and skilled leader.

Early Life and Education

Born on November 26, 1945, von Sydow grew up with a strong interest in politics and public service. He pursued higher education, earning a Ph.D. in political science from Linkping University in 1978. This academic background laid the foundation for his future career in politics.

Political Career

Von Sydow's political journey began when he joined the Swedish Social Democratic Party. He served as Minister of Defence in Gran Persson's government from 1997 to 2002, and later as Minister of Commerce and Industry for a brief period. His experience in these roles prepared him for the esteemed position of Speaker of the Riksdag.

Speaker of the Riksdag

As Speaker, von Sydow played a vital role in leading the Riksdag sessions and ensuring the smooth functioning of the parliament. He was also eligible to serve as acting regent (Riksfrestndare) in the absence of the King and his three children, although this scenario never occurred during his tenure.

Personal Life and Legacy

Von Sydow is a distant relative of the renowned actor Max von Sydow. He lives in Solna, outside Stockholm, with his wife and four children. His commitment to public service and his dedication to the betterment of Swedish politics have left a lasting impact on the country.
